Youme
01-23-2008, 10:26 AM
i think you have hte bloom set up too high. its kind of bight
This is what I said, you need an env_tonemap_control to limmit the amount the HDR can change by, all the TF2 maps have it quite restricted from the norm, portal also has it quite restricted.
I'm not suggesting you remove it too much I think it should be quite bright when you go outside but I think at the moment it is too bright
